Chemical compounds in place of paper



Cellulose is a protracted chain of carbohydrate (sugar) molecules and money owed for approximately -thirds of wooden's weight. "it's far especially used for paper manufacturing, and the residuals might be higher valorised by way of being converted into useful chemical compounds," says Sviatlana Siankevich of EPFL's Institute of Chemical Sciences and Engineering. With colleagues from Queen's college in Canada and the countrywide college of Singapore, the EPFL team led by chemist Paul Dyson synthesised several styles of ionic drinks (molten salts) to convert cellulose into HMF, an important molecule for the manufacturing of commodity chemical substances. In a unmarried step, their reaction reached a 62% yield, a new document.

"Our technique operates at mild situations, that is, without very high temperatures or strain or robust acids," says Siankevich. "we have also been able to lessen the quantity of undesired through-merchandise, an vital factor if the response is to be scaled up for business strategies. Our method can paintings with wooden, however it is regularly less difficult to apply cellulose extracted from herbaceous flowers."
